Comparing Effectiveness: Semaglutide versus Phentermine

In evaluating the effectiveness of weight loss medications, Semaglutide and Phentermine exhibit distinct mechanisms and outcomes. Semaglutide, a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ist, promotes weight loss by enhancing insulin secretion and decreasing appetite, causing significant reductions in body weight over extended periods. Clinical trials have shown that patients using Semaglutide can lose a substantial percentage of their body weight, often exceeding 15% in some cases.

Conversely, Phentermine is a stimulant that suppresses appetite, chiefly through its impact on the central nervous system. While it can produce noticeable weight loss, the results are typically more modest and frequently short-term. Phentermine is typically prescribed for a limited duration due to potential side effects and dependency concerns. Overall, while both medications can be effective, Semaglutide may provide a more enduring and comprehensive approach to weight management when contrasted with Phentermine.

How Semaglutide Works for Weight Loss

Semaglutide functions as a weight loss treatment by imitating the activity of the GLP-1 hormone, which plays a crucial role in managing appetite and glucose metabolism. By connecting with GLP-1 receptors in the brain, Semaglutide enhances feelings of fullness and satiety, leading to reduced food intake. This hormone also reduces gastric emptying, which prolongs the sensation of fullness after meals. Additionally, Semaglutide favorably affects insulin secretion in response to meals, serving to stabilize blood sugar levels.

Medical studies have indicated that individuals taking Semaglutide undergo considerable weight loss compared to those not undergoing the treatment. The medication is generally administered through a weekly injection, making it a user-friendly option for persons seeking help in their read guide weight loss journey. On the whole, Semaglutide's multifaceted approach to hunger management and glucose management makes it an effective tool for those striving to achieve and maintain a healthier weight.

How Phentermine Facilitates Weight Loss

Phentermine acts as an appetite suppressant, predominantly by stimulating the release of brain neurotransmitters that help lower hunger. This drug elevates levels of norepinephrine, dopamine, and serotonin, which work together to suppress appetite and enhance feelings of satiety. By reducing the desire to eat, Phentermine helps individuals in following calorie-restricted diets, making weight loss more achievable.

Along with appetite suppression, Phentermine can boost energy levels, which may stimulate increased physical activity. This combination of reduced hunger and improved energy can create a conducive environment for weight loss. The medication is typically prescribed for short-term use, allowing individuals to jumpstart their weight loss journey.

Phentermine's efficacy is most notable when paired with lifestyle changes, including a healthy diet and regular workout routine. As a result, it functions as a tool that, when used appropriately, can facilitate significant weight loss efforts.

Understanding the Potential Side Effects and Safety Aspects of Semaglutide and Phentermine

While both Semaglutide and Phentermine are applied for weight loss, they possess distinct potential side effects and safety considerations that users should be mindful of. Semaglutide, a GLP-1 receptor agonist, may result in gastrointestinal problems such as nausea, diarrhea, and vomiting. Furthermore, there is a risk of pancreatitis and potential thyroid tumors, which requires observation by healthcare providers.

Conversely, Phentermine, a stimulant, can lead to increased heart rate, elevated blood pressure, and insomnia. It may also trigger mood changes and dependency issues with prolonged use. As a result of these side effects, both medications require careful consideration of individual health conditions. Patients with specific cardiovascular issues or a history of substance abuse should consult their healthcare providers to assess risk factors. Understanding these side effects is crucial for making informed decisions concerning weight loss strategies.

Who Should Think About Phentermine or Semaglutide?

Who could benefit from medications like Semaglutide or Phentermine for weight loss? Those battling obesity or overweight may find these medications valuable, especially when traditional weight loss approaches, such as diet and exercise, have not worked. Semaglutide is generally recommended for those with a body mass index (BMI) of 30 or above, or a BMI of 27 or above with weight-related health issues. Phentermine can be suitable for those with a BMI of 30 or above, or those with a BMI of 27 with associated health problems.

In addition, both drugs may be considered for patients who are unable to achieve sustainable weight loss through lifestyle adjustments alone. Those who have a strong drive and determination to a comprehensive weight management plan, including regular medical guidance, may also profit significantly from these pharmacological options. Consulting healthcare practitioners for personalized direction is essential for determining the most appropriate choice.

Performance Analysis

Though both semaglutide and phentermine are popular choices for weight loss, their effectiveness can vary significantly depending on personal circumstances and health profiles. Semaglutide, a GLP-1 receptor agonist, has been proven to deliver substantial weight loss results in clinical trials, often producing a drop in body weight of 15% or more over a year. In contrast, phentermine, an appetite suppressant, can help users achieve weight loss, but results tend to be more modest, generally around 5% to 10% of body weight within a comparable timeframe. Elements such as commitment to dietary changes, exercise routines, and individual metabolic responses can affect the outcomes of these medications, making personalized consultation vital for determining the most effective choice.

What Financial Costs Come With Each Medication?

Costs for Semaglutide generally span from $800 to $1,200 per month without insurance, while Phentermine is typically more affordable, costing $30 to $100 per month. Costs can differ according to location, pharmacy, and insurance coverage.
